Lithuania - Unemployment Rate for Women with Advanced Education

Since 2014, Lithuania Unemployment Rate for Women with Advanced Education was down by 9.5points year on year. With 2.61 Percent of Female Labor Force with Advanced Education in 2019, the country was ranked number 93 among other countries in Unemployment Rate for Women with Advanced Education. Lithuania is overtaken by Moldova, which was ranked number 92 at 2.72 Percent of Female Labor Force with Advanced Education and is followed by Israel with 2.43 Percent of Female Labor Force with Advanced Education. Palestine ranked the highest with 46.94 Percent of Female Labor Force with Advanced Education in 2019, that is a decrease of 5.4points versus 2018. Tunisia, Mali and Egypt resp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Brazil witnessed the best average annual growth at +37.4points per year, while Myanmar was the worst growing country at -34.4points per year.
